Ventless design

A ventless electric wall-mounted fireplace is an ideal space-saving option for homes without chimneys. This type of fireplace works well in rooms where installing a traditional ventless gas fireplace would be costly or difficult to install. They also require little maintenance and are more cost-effective to operate than gas fires. They make use of blowers to heat the air in the room and can be switched on or off quickly.

One of the most common methods to make a fire look realistic is to use LED lights that replicate the look of flames. The lights can be reflected using mirrors or other materials to create illusions of depth and motion. Some models are even equipped with a water vapor system that produces a realistic-looking smoke effect. The Dimplex Opti-Myst uses a combination of video and water mist to achieve an amazing flame effect that is sure to awe guests.

A great option for those looking for an electric fireplace for the wall is the PuraFlame Serena 50" model. This sleek design features an attractive tempered glass front and can be hung directly on the wall or in recesses. It also has an remote control, which means you can easily change the lighting and settings.

This model draws 1500W of power to provide additional heating for rooms of up to 400 square feet. It is highly efficient and shouldn't cost you more than $0.20 an hour to operate. You can also adjust the temperature to the desired setting and enjoy its near-silent operation.

The unit's modern design is enhanced by LED lighting which creates realistic flame effects across the entire width of the unit. This is enhanced by a dazzling Cynergy(tm) pebble stone ember bed for an authentic appearance. You can select from a variety of colors and speeds to create the perfect mood. The ember bed may also be converted to faux logs for an extra level of authenticity.

When selecting a wall-mounted electrical fireplace, make sure that it has a UL approved 3-prong plug. It should also be plugged into a designated electrical outlet. Do not use an extension cord or connect other electronic devices to the same outlet. This could result in overheating. Also, make sure that all combustible materials are kept at least three feet away from the fireplace to reduce fire risk.
